Abstract
BF3-mediated allylation of 1, 2-naphthoquinone and its 3-substituted derivativea with allyl- ,(2-methyl-2-propenyl)-, trans-2-butenyl-, and (3-methyl-2-buteny1) trialkyltin afforded selectively the corresponding 4-allyl-1, 2-naphthalenediols, which were isolated as diacetate or quinone. In the reactions with trans-2-butenyltributyltin, the regioisomer ratio of the a-vs. yadduct depends on the nature of substituents in position 3 of quinones. The ...
